15 Best Colour Paint for Outside Houses in Nigeria

1. Sky Blue

Sky blue evokes feelings of tranquillity and peace, perfect for creating a serene home environment. This hue has gained significant popularity among Nigerian homeowners due to its cool undertones that reflect the country’s warm climate.

2. Ivory White

Ivory white is a timeless and elegant choice that offers a crisp, clean look. The brilliance of this hue shines brightly under Nigeria’s sunlight, giving your house a fresh and inviting look.

3. Earthy Brown

Earthy brown resonates with Nigeria’s natural landscapes. It’s an excellent colour for larger homes as it blends seamlessly with the surroundings, giving the structure a grounded and organic feel.

4. Sunny Yellow

Sunny yellow is vibrant, cheerful, and reminiscent of Nigeria’s abundant sunshine. This lively colour can transform your house into a beacon of warmth and positivity.15 Best Colour Paint for Outside House in Nigeria

5. Rustic Orange

Rustic orange is a traditional colour often used in Nigerian homes. It has an earthy undertone that beautifully complements Nigeria’s natural beauty and cultural heritage.

6. Olive Green

Olive green signifies growth, nature, and tranquillity, giving your house a calming and inviting appeal. It’s an excellent choice for those who want their homes to blend with the greenery around them.

7. Subtle Gray

Subtle gray is an understated yet sophisticated choice that works with virtually any architectural style. It’s an elegant option for those seeking a modern, minimalistic look.

8. Royal Blue

Royal blue is a rich, bold colour that exudes a sense of luxury and grandeur. If you want to make a bold statement, this hue might be the perfect choice.NYSC Portal

9. Pastel Pink

Pastel pink is a fun and youthful colour that can add a charming touch to your home’s exterior. It is an excellent choice for homeowners looking to give their homes a playful and unique character.

10. Terra Cotta Red

Terra cotta red is reminiscent of traditional Nigerian pottery, a testament to the country’s rich cultural heritage. This colour offers a warm, welcoming vibe, perfect for a homely appearance.

11. Sand Beige

Sand beige is a neutral yet appealing choice that subtly echoes the vast Nigerian landscapes. This shade is a versatile choice that pairs well with a variety of accent colours.

12. Brick Red

Brick red is a robust, traditional colour that lends a sense of solidity and durability to your home. It is reminiscent of the common brick houses found throughout the country.

13. Classic Black

Classic black, though bold, offers a chic and modern look. When used wisely, it can turn your house into a statement piece against the colourful Nigerian backdrop.JAMB Portal

14. Lavender Purple

Lavender purple can lend a whimsical, unique character to your home. This charming hue stands out beautifully under the Nigerian sunlight, creating an enchanting façade.

15. Vibrant Turquoise

Vibrant turquoise is a distinctive choice that brings to mind the country’s stunning coastal regions. This refreshing hue can make your home look inviting and fun.15 Best Orthopedic Mattress In Nigeria

Choosing the right colour for the exterior of your home is an important decision that will impact the overall appeal and aesthetic of your property. It’s about choosing a colour that not only matches your personal style but also complements the architectural design and the surrounding environment.200 Romantic Love Message

Choosing the Right Colour

When selecting a paint colour, take into account the architectural style and era of your house. Some colours work better with traditional designs, while others complement modern styles. Your roof colour is another factor to consider, as it should harmoniously blend with your chosen paint.

Consider the environment and the neighbourhood, as well. If your house is surrounded by lush greenery, earthy tones like olive green or earthy brown might be suitable. If your home is in a bustling urban area, a bold colour like royal blue or classic black could make a striking statement.105 Good Morning Love Messages

The climate should also influence your decision. Light colours are excellent at reflecting heat, making them ideal for Nigeria’s warm climate. Examples are ivory white, sky blue, and pastel pink.InformationGuideNigeria

Finally, personal preference is key. Your home is your sanctuary and should reflect your taste and personality.

Durability and Maintenance

While aesthetics are important, the durability of the paint is equally significant. It should withstand Nigeria’s tropical climate that can cause colour fading. Look for high-quality paints designed for exterior use. These paints often come with properties like UV resistance, weather resistance, and low maintenance.
